not really for sure. Made 10 passes at the track the day this happened. Took a friend for a ride that evening and it just went just as I got into drive gear. I think either a rod gave way and took out the piston which took out everything in it's path or it went lean and the piston came apart. The air was pretty cool and I was spinning it to 6900.
